How much does it cost to rent an apartment in The Hills?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
The Hills Studio Apartments | $1,044 | $986 | $1,067 |
The Hills 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,617 | $1,010 | $2,895 |
The Hills 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,992 | $1,110 | $3,185 |
The Hills 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,476 | $1,399 | $4,495 |
The Hills 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,432 | $2,160 | $2,638 |

Getting Around The Hills, TX
Walk Score®
15 / 100
Car-Dependent
Almost all errands require a car
Bike Score®
23 / 100
Somewhat Bikeable
Minimal bike infrastructure
